Karl’s math class is playing a number game. Each student is given a number card containing the numbers 1 to 6. The rules of the
Lena [83]

By finding the probability, we can expect that 2 out of the 30 students will win the prize.

<h3>How many of the 30 students will win the prize?</h3>

First, we should get the probability of winning this game.

Here the students select two numbers out of 6, just to make the calculations let's say that these numbers are 1 and 2.

Now, we need to get these two numbers in two balls. The probability of getting the ball with the number 1 out of the 6 balls is:

p = 1/6

The probability of getting the ball with the number 2 out of the remaining 5 balls (because we already got one) is:

q = 1/5

The joint probability is then:

P = 2*(1/6)*(1/5) = 1/15.

Where the factor 2 comes to take in account the permutations, for the case where we first draw the number 2 and then the number 1.

Then the expected number of students that will win is equal to the probability times the total number of students:

(1/15)*30 = 2

So out of the 30 students, we can expect that 2 will win.

One tank is filling at at a rate of 3/4 gallon per 2/3 minutes. A second tank is filling at a rate of 5/8 gallon per 1/2 minutes
VMariaS [17]
3/4 times 3/2 (reciprocal of the second fraction) is 9/8 gallons per minute.
5/8 times 2/1 (reciprocal of the second fraction) is 10/8 gallons per minute

The second tank is filling faster.

The two figures are congruent find the measure of the requested side or angle
antiseptic1488 [7]
You have not provided the figures, therefore, I cannot provide an exact answer.
However, I can helps you with the steps.

One important thing to note is that when writing statements of congruency, the order of writing the letters is very important. This is because each side/angle in the first figure would be congruent to the corresponding side/angle in the second.

Therefore, all you have to do in the above question is write the congruent figures and determine the corresponding congruent sides/angles

Example:
If we are given that triangle ABC is congruent to triangle DEF
This means that:
AB = DE
BC = EF
AC = DF
angle A = angle D
angle B = angle E
angle C = angle F
